ORDINANCE N0. 83- 19 <br />Page -3- <br />capacity to the Mayor for the planning. preparation and <br />supervision of the annual Village Days event. <br />131.04 CITIZENS ADVISORY COMMITTEE <br />(a) There is hereby established the Citizens Advisory <br />Committee which shall be constituted and have such powers <br />and duties as hereinafter set forth. <br />(b) The Citizens Advisory Committee shall consist of not <br />more than fifteen (15) members, all of whom shall be <br />appointed by the Mayor on or af ter January 1 of each year, <br />such appointments subject to the concurrence of a majority <br />of the members elected to Council. All members shall be <br />residents of the municipality and shall not hold other <br />municipal office or appointment. The Committee shall select <br />one of its members to serve as its Chairman. <br />(c) Members of the Citizens Advisory Committee shall serve <br />on the Committee until December 31st of the year in which <br />they were appointed. IfP for any reason, there is a <br />vacancy on the Committee and the Mayor determines that <br />such vacancy should be filled, then the appointment of a <br />successor shall be made in the same manner as an original <br />appointment. <br />(d) The members of the Citizens Advisory Committee shall <br />serve without compensation. <br />(e) Pursuant to the terms of the Charter, the Mayor shall <br />supervise the functions and duties of the Citizens Advisory <br />Committee. Unless otherwise provided by the riayor, the <br />Chairman of the Committee shall establish meeting dates for <br />the Committee and shall preside at all meetings. <br />(f) Unless otherwise provided by the Mayor, it is the <br />function of the Citizens Advisory Committee to review matters <br />of general concern regarding the management, operation and <br />effectiveness of the Village government and its various <br />officials, departments, boards and commissions. <br />Section 2.
